Faris Sets Region Record in 50 Yard Freestyle

St. Patrick senior Colin Faris won the the 50 yard freestyle and the 100 yard freestyle in the Region 4 Swimming Championships. Faris set a regional record and the pool record in the 50 yard freestyle with a time of 20.93. That was a personal best time for Faris and 00.11 off the state record. It's third fastest time ever by a male swimmer in the 50 yard freestyle in the state. Faris won the 100 yard freestyle with an all-american consideration time of 47.03.
Deming sophomore Amanda Miller won the 100 yard breastroke with a personal best time of 1:09.36. Miller was second in the 50 yard freestyle with a personal best time of 24.93.
Faris and Miller both qualified for the state meet in both of their races. The state meet is this Friday and Saturday at the Ralph Wright Natatorium in Louisville.
St. Patrick's boys' relay team qualified for the region finals in the 200 yard freestyle and came in 10th with a time of 1:46. 79. The relay team was led by Faris, who swam his 50 yard leg in 21.29. Sophomore Anthony Chamblin was next with a time of 27.98. Then came 8th grader Russell Rigg with a time of 28.65 and junior Zachary Rigg with a time of 28.87.
